The most noticeable side effect was myoclonus—violent jerking of my arms and legs. It usually happened when I was trying to go to sleep at night, but it could also be triggered in other situations by stress or alcohol. I found that I was able to suppress the movement, but doing so was extremely unpleasant—a sort of painless agony, if that makes any sense. On one occasion, I actually begged my girlfriend at the time to cut my leg off so it would stop jumping around by itself. A small dose of clonazepam helped, but failed to fix the problem entirely.
